Luke 6:36
Be full of pity, even as your Father is full of pity.

--------------------


Leviticus 11:45
For I am the Lord, who took you out of the land of Egypt, to be your God; so be you holy, for I am holy.

-----

Deuteronomy 10:15
But the Lord had delight in your fathers and love for them, marking out for himself their seed after them, even you, from all peoples, as at this day.

1 Samuel 20:14
And may you, while I am still living, O may you be kind to me, as the Lord is kind, and keep me from death!

2 Samuel 9:3
And the king said, Is there anyone of Saul's family still living, to whom I may be a friend in God's name? And Ziba said, There is a son of Jonathan, whose feet are damaged.

Titus 3:3
For in the past we were foolish, hard in heart, turned from the true way, servants of evil desires and pleasures, living in bad feeling and envy, hated and hating one another.

Titus 3:4
But when the mercy of God our Saviour, and his love to man was seen,

Deuteronomy 15:7
If in any of your towns in the land which the Lord your God is giving you, there is a poor man, one of your countrymen, do not let your heart be hard or your hand shut to him;

Deuteronomy 15:10
But it is right for you to give to him, without grief of heart: for because of this, the blessing of the Lord your God will be on all your work and on everything to which you put your hand.

Psalms 41:1
To the chief music-maker. A Psalm. Of David. Happy is the man who gives thought to the poor; the Lord will be his saviour in the time of trouble.

Psalms 41:2
The Lord will keep him safe, and give him life; the Lord will let him be a blessing on the earth, and will not give him into the hand of his haters.

Psalms 112:5
All is well for the man who is kind and gives freely to others; he will make good his cause when he is judged.

Proverbs 19:17
He who has pity on the poor gives to the Lord, and the Lord will give him his reward.

Isaiah 57:1
The upright man goes to his death, and no one gives a thought to it; and god-fearing men are taken away, and no one is troubled by it; for the upright man is taken away because of evil-doing, and goes into peace.

Isaiah 57:2
They are at rest in their last resting-places, every one going straight before him.

Daniel 4:27
For this cause, O King, let my suggestion be pleasing to you, and let your sins be covered by righteousness and your evil-doing by mercy to the poor, so that the time of your well-being may be longer.

Joel 2:13
Let your hearts be broken, and not your clothing, and come back to the Lord your God: for he is full of grace and pity, slow to be angry and great in mercy, ready to be turned from his purpose of punishment.

Micah 6:8
He has made clear to you, O man, what is good; and what is desired from you by the Lord; only doing what is right, and loving mercy, and walking without pride before your God.

Matthew 6:15
But if you do not let men have forgiveness for their sins, you will not have forgiveness from your Father for your sins.

Matthew 18:34
And his lord was very angry, and put him in the hands of those who would give him punishment till he made payment of all the debt.

Matthew 18:35
So will my Father in heaven do to you, if you do not everyone, from your hearts, give forgiveness to his brother.

Matthew 5:46
For if you have love for those who have love for you, what credit is it to you? do not the tax-farmers the same?

Matthew 6:1
Take care not to do your good works before men, to be seen by them; or you will have no reward from your Father in heaven.

Matthew 6:2
When then you give money to the poor, do not make a noise about it, as the false-hearted men do in the Synagogues and in the streets, so that they may have glory from men. Truly, I say to you, They have their reward.

Matthew 6:3
But when you give money, let not your left hand see what your right hand does:

Matthew 6:4
So that your giving may be in secret; and your Father, who sees in secret, will give you your reward.

-----

Acts 10:38
About Jesus of Nazareth, how God gave the Holy Spirit to him, with power: and how he went about doing good and making well all who were troubled by evil spirits, for God was with him.

2 Corinthians 8:8
I am not giving you an order, but using the ready mind of others as a test of the quality of your love.

2 Corinthians 8:9
For you see the grace of our Lord Jesus Christ, how though he had wealth, he became poor on your account, so that through his need you might have wealth.

1 Peter 2:21
This is God's purpose for you: because Jesus himself underwent punishment for you, giving you an example, so that you might go in his footsteps:

1 John 3:16
In this we see what love is, because he gave his life for us; and it is right for us to give our lives for the brothers.

1 John 3:18
My little children, do not let our love be in word and in tongue, but let it be in act and in good faith.

1 John 4:9
And the love of God was made clear to us when he sent his only Son into the world so that we might have life through him.

1 John 4:10
And this is love, not that we had love for God, but that he had love for us, and sent his Son to be an offering for our sins.
